Vue.js 是一款流行的 JavaScript 框架,廣泛應用于前端開發中。在 Vue 中,拷貝字符串是一項常見的任務。Vue 提供了多種方式來實現字符串拷貝的功能,本文將介紹其中兩種常用方式。
首先,我們可以使用 JavaScript 自帶的字符串拷貝方法,如下所示:
let str = 'Vue.js'; let copiedStr = str.slice(); console.log(copiedStr); // 輸出 Vue.js
在以上代碼中,我們使用 slice() 方法來實現字符串拷貝。該方法會返回一個新的字符串,其內容與被拷貝字符串相同。
除此之外,還可以使用 Vue 自帶的 deepCopy 方法來拷貝字符串。示例代碼如下:
let str = 'Vue.js'; let copiedStr = Vue.util.extend(true, {}, str); console.log(copiedStr); // 輸出 Vue.js
在以上代碼中,我們使用 Vue.util.extend() 方法來實現字符串的深拷貝。該方法會將拷貝后的字符串作為一個新的對象返回,該對象與原字符串沒有關聯。
綜上所述,Vue.js 提供了多種實現字符串拷貝的方法。我們可以根據實際情況選擇適合的方法來完成字符串拷貝的任務。